President Ma Ying-jeou held a press conference on May 19, 2010, to mark its second anniversary in office. During the event, reported on the work he and his government have done, including the promotion of clean government and rule of law remains where it seeks to eradicate the abuse of power, carrying out political and economic reforms, promoting mutual tolerance and dialogue between the ruling and opposition parties as well as opening direct cross the Taiwan Strait and Taiwan's expanding engagement in international affairs. The fruits of these efforts have begun to emerge, he said. addition, the President outlined a vision for creating a "golden decade" for the nation. Strengthening the country through innovation, revival of the country through the promotion of culture, the maintenance of the country by protecting the environment, stabilizing the country by adhering to the Constitution, ensuring country improve social welfare and protecting the country by promoting peace.
As strengthened through innovation, President Ma said that innovation is the key to competitiveness and Taiwan must be innovative to survive and prosper in the global arena. While Taiwan has established an excellent track record of innovation, adding that still needs to strengthen its research and development and manufacturing capacity self-sufficient in certain key technological areas. The government will select a number of them as a focus for future development.
With regard to cultural development, the President expressed the belief Taiwan's core values \u200b\u200bare openness and entrepreneurship, with kindness, diligence, sincerity and tolerance. Externally, these qualities are reflected in the oceanic nation, diverse and innovative culture and its traditions of volunteerism and compassionate action. The government continues its efforts to make the nation's educational environment more open and international levels to help universities offering study programs in English in order to coordinate and evaluate their programs in order to attract foreign students to Taiwan. The goal is to double the number of foreign students at universities in Taiwan, thereby exerting a positive pressure on local students for the competition to excel in their studies.
As measures of environmental protection, President Ma said the creation of a country with low carbon emissions is the trend worldwide. In the future, said the government would spare no efforts to promote the enactment of the legislation. All this will make it possible to develop a low carbon economy through the use of green energy, increasing energy efficiency by 2 percent per year, and encouraging the use of renewable energy. In addition, emphasis will be on a carbon trading system and development of cities model, low carbon and communities.
As to the constitutional policy, President Ma said that in 2010, the World Competitiveness Yearbook based in Switzerland, the International Institute for Management Development in Lausanne rates have indicated that the government of Taiwan is the sixth most efficient in the world, which takes a big leap from No. 18 that was last year, marking the history . Moreover, he stressed, the government will not back down in their efforts to continue the honest governance and increase administrative efficiency and strengthen their spirit of service and continue to work hard to fully achieve these goals.
Regarding the development of social welfare, President Ma said that despite the social safety net in Taiwan is not bad in its scope of services but it must be improved, since these are the areas in which the government must redouble its efforts in the future also include the following two major concerns:
The construction of a prosperous society that justice must not neglect distributive and should not allow the gap between high-income groups and low growing. The social safety net should be adjusted depending on the country's birth rate falling through comprehensive planning that encourages young people to marry and have kids.
With regard to ensuring peace, the President reiterated that Taiwan seeks to develop relations with mainland China under the Constitution of the Republic of China (Taiwan), based on the principles of no unification, no independence and no use of force. Their cross-strait policies undoubtedly ensure that the country can maintain the dignity of Taiwan and China's sovereignty. Across the Strait, to achieve a framework agreement on economic cooperation will take place in this spirit, he said.
In conclusion, President Ma said that, looking back at the history of nation-building of the Republic of China (Taiwan), is standing at a crucial time when the nation is approaching its centenary. Trust their administration can maintain the prosperity of Taiwan and peace, which is the reason to share his vision of the golden decade approaching. Ma has faith ... he added, that the people of Taiwan should demonstrate its wisdom and courage to face the challenges ahead.
